Annuaire de L'aéronautique
Founded in 1907 by a group of aviation enthusiasts in Paris, Île-de-France, Annuaire de L'aéronautique has played a pivotal role in documenting the evolution of aviation. This publication has chronicled significant milestones in aeronautics, including developments in technology, regulations, and notable flights, featuring a rich array of content that caters to both aviation professionals and enthusiasts.
